热 (rè)
adjective · Beginner · Adjectives
Meaning
English: Hot
Having a high temperature.
Examples
🗣 夏天的上海很热。
💬 Shanghai is very hot in summer.
Etymology
‘热’ (rè) has origins in describing temperature and warmth, historically linked to both physical heat and emotional intensity.
How & Where It’s Used
‘热’ is frequently used in spoken language, especially in discussing weather or temperature. It appears in both formal and informal registers across regions.
